Печатаемый текст задается в свойстве StringForPrinting. Максимальная допустимая длина печатаемой строки 249 символов. Если длина строки в свойстве StringForPrinting меньше максимальной допустимой, строка дополняется пробелами справа. Если длина строки превышает максимальное допустимое значение, то оставшиеся символы на уровне драйвера игнорируются.
Перед вызовом метода в свойстве Password указать пароль оператора.
В свойстве OperatorNumber возвращается порядковый номер оператора, чей пароль был введен.
Метод может вызываться в любом режиме, кроме режимов 11, 12 и 14 (см. свойство ECRMode).
Не меняет режима ККМ.
Используем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
Password | Целое | до 8 разрядов | RW | Числовой параметр, содержащий пароль для исполнения команд различных методов драйвера. | 190 |
UseReceiptRibbon | Логич. | – | RW | Признак операции с чековой лентой. FALSE – не производить операцию над чековой лентой, TRUE – производить операцию над чековой лентой. | 228 |
UseJournalRibbon | Логич. | – | RW | Признак операции с лентой операционного журнала: FALSE – не производить операцию над лентой операционного журнала, TRUE – производить операцию над лентой. | 228 |
StringForPrinting | Строка | не более 249 символов | RW | Строка символов кодовой таблицы WIN1251 для печати. | 202 |
Модифицируем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
OperatorNumber | Целое | 1..30 | R | Порядковый номер оператора, чей пароль был введен. | 190 |
PrintStringWithFont ПечатьСтрокиДаннымШрифтом
Метод служит для печати строки символов на чековой ленте и/или на контрольной ленте (в операционном журнале) неким шрифтом из набора шрифтов, номер которого указывается в свойстве FontType. В свойствах UseReceiptRibbon, UseJournalRibbon указывается, на какой из лент будет распечатан текст: значение свойства TRUE показывает, что текст будет выведен на соответствующей ленте. Если оба значения свойств равны TRUE, то производится одновременная печать на чековой и контрольной ленте (в операционном журнале).
Печатаемый текст задается в свойстве StringForPrinting. Максимальная допустимая длина печатаемой строки 248 символов. Если длина строки в свойстве StringForPrinting меньше максимальной допустимой, строка дополняется пробелами справа. Если длина строки превышает максимальное допустимое значение, то оставшиеся символы на уровне драйвера игнорируются.
Перед вызовом метода в свойстве Password указать пароль оператора.
В свойстве OperatorNumber возвращается порядковый номер оператора, чей пароль был введен.
Метод может вызываться в любом режиме, кроме режимов 11, 12 и 14 (см. свойство ECRMode).
Не меняет режима ККМ.
Используем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
Password | Целое | до 8 разрядов | RW | Числовой параметр, содержащий пароль для исполнения команд различных методов драйвера. | 190 |
UseReceiptRibbon | Логич. | – | RW | Признак операции с чековой лентой. FALSE – не производить операцию над чековой лентой, TRUE – производить операцию над чековой лентой. | 228 |
UseJournalRibbon | Логич. | – | RW | Признак операции с лентой операционного журнала: FALSE – не производить операцию над лентой операционного журнала, TRUE – производить операцию над лентой. | 228 |
StringForPrinting | Строка | не более 248 символов | RW | Строка символов кодовой таблицы WIN1251 для печати. | 202 |
FontType | Целое | 1..7 | RW | Тип шрифта при печати строки. | 178 |
Модифицируем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
OperatorNumber | Целое | 1..30 | R | Порядковый номер оператора, чей пароль был введен. | 190 |
PrintWideString ПечатьЖирнойСтроки
Метод служит для печати строки символов на чековой ленте и/или на контрольной ленте (в операционном журнале) жирным шрифтом. В свойствах UseReceiptRibbon, UseJournalRibbon указывается, на какой из лент будет распечатан текст: значение свойства TRUE показывает, что текст будет выведен на соответствующей ленте. Если оба значения свойств равны TRUE, то производится одновременная печать на чековой и контрольной ленте (в операционном журнале).
Печатаемый текст задается в свойстве StringForPrinting. Максимальная допустимая длина печатаемой строки 249 символов. Если длина строки в свойстве StringForPrinting меньше максимальной допустимой, строка дополняется пробелами справа. Если длина строки превышает максимальное допустимое значение, то оставшиеся символы на уровне драйвера игнорируются.
Перед вызовом метода в свойстве Password указать пароль оператора.
В свойстве OperatorNumber возвращается порядковый номер оператора, чей пароль был введен.
Метод может вызываться в любом режиме, кроме режимов 11, 12 и 14 (см. свойство ECRMode).
Не меняет режима ККМ.
Используем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
Password | Целое | до 8 разрядов | RW | Числовой параметр, содержащий пароль для исполнения команд различных методов драйвера. | 190 |
UseReceiptRibbon | Логич. | - | RW | Признак операции с чековой лентой. FALSE – не производить операцию над чековой лентой, TRUE – производить операцию над чековой лентой. | 228 |
UseJournalRibbon | Логич. | - | RW | Признак операции с лентой операционного журнала: FALSE – не производить операцию над лентой операционного журнала, TRUE – производить операцию над лентой. | 228 |
StringForPrinting | Строка | не более 249 символов | RW | Строка символов кодовой таблицы WIN1251 для печати. | 202 |
Модифицируем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
OperatorNumber | Целое | 1..30 | R | Порядковый номер оператора, чей пароль был введен. | 190 |
Test ТестовыйПрогон
Эта команда запускает тестовый прогон ККМ, т. е. печать тестового чека через определенные промежутки времени. Перед вызовом метода в свойстве Password указать пароль оператора. Перед исполнением команды необходимо заполнить свойство RunningPeriod, в котором указать период печати тестового чека в минутах (значение 0 недопустимо). Прерывается тестовый прогон ККМ только командой InterruptTest. В свойстве OperatorNumber возвращается порядковый номер оператора, чей пароль был введен.
Работает в режимах 2, 3, 4, 7, 9 и 16 (см. свойство ECRMode).
Переводит ККМ или принтер в режим 10 (см. свойство ECRMode) (возврат в прежний режим – вызов метода InterruptTest).
Используем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
Password | Целое | до 8 разрядов | RW | Числовой параметр, содержащий пароль для исполнения команд различных методов драйвера. | 190 |
RunningPeriod | Целое | 1..99 | RW | Период вывода тестового чека в минутах в режиме тестового прогона. | 199 |
Модифицируемые свойства | |||||
Название | Тип | Диапазон/длина | Доступ | Расшифровка | Стр. |
OperatorNumber | Целое | 1..30 | R | Порядковый номер оператора, чей пароль был введен. | 190 |
Методы работы с графикой
Ниже приводится описание методов работы с графикой для фискальных регистраторов, экспортируемых в страны, где работа ККМ с графикой разрешена.
|
Из за большого объема этот материал размещен на нескольких страницах: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 |


